Dillingham Airport
Dillingham Airport is a medium airport serving Dillingham, United States, and it plays an important role for travelers moving in and out of this remote part of Alaska. Its codes are DLG for airline bookings and baggage tags, and PADL for aviation and flight planning. Sitting at an elevation of 81 feet (25 m), the airport is straightforward to identify on itineraries and maps, and it is the main air gateway travelers should look for when arranging arrival or departure to the Dillingham area.

Key facts
- Airport name: Dillingham Airport
- IATA code: DLG
- ICAO code: PADL
- Airport type: medium airport
- Runway: 01/19, 6,400 feet, asphalt, lighted
- Time zone: America/Anchorage
Runway and operations
For pilots and aviation-minded travelers, Dillingham Airport has one runway, 01/19, measuring 6,400 feet and surfaced in asphalt, with lighting available. In practical terms, that means the airport is equipped for regular fixed-wing operations and supports arrivals and departures in a wide range of everyday conditions. Even for non-aviation visitors, runway length and lighting matter because they help indicate the airport’s ability to handle scheduled service and maintain operations during darker periods that are common in Alaska through much of the year.
